ORBAN IN CONGRATULATORY MESSAGE TO MINIĆ: SRPSKA CAN CONTINUE TO COUNT ON HUNGARY’S UNWAVERING SUPPORT

BANJA LUKA, SEPTEMBER 18 /SRNA/ –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ban congratulated Republika Srpska Prime Minister Savo Minić on his appointment to the post, wishing him great success in his responsible work and good health.
“I am pleased that thanks to our joint efforts, our relations, based on mutual respect and appreciation, have reached an enviable level,” Orban stated in his message. Orban said that the Hungarian Government will continue to work devotedly on deepening bilateral cooperation with Srpska and on expanding cooperation into new areas. “In this spirit, I confirm that Republika Srpska can continue to count on Hungary’s unwavering support, and I look forward to continuing the joint work we have begun,” Orbán added. Minić wrote on the social network X that he was delighted by the congratulatory message from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ban, to whom he sincerely expressed gratitude for his attention, friendship, and support for the Serbian people.
